Machinify is a leading healthcare intelligence company with expertise across the payment continuum, delivering unmatched value, transparency, and efficiency to health plan clients across the country. Deployed by over 85 health plans, including many of the top 20, and representing more than 270 million lives, Machinify brings together a fully configurable and content-rich, AI-powered platform along with best-in-class expertise. We’re constantly reimagining what’s possible in our industry, creating disruptively simple, powerfully clear ways to maximize financial outcomes and drive down healthcare costs.

About the Opportunity

At Machinify, we’re constantly reimagining what’s possible in our industry—creating disruptively simple, powerfully clear ways to maximize our clients’ financial outcomes today and drive down healthcare costs tomorrow. As part of the Customer Success Team, you will, as a Client Delivery Analyst, be responsible for facilitating the work product between Machinify and our clients across Complex Payment Solutions.  This person will understand internal and client processes, handle internal and external client requirements gathering, analysis, solution documentation, integration and delivery validation.  This person will recommend best practice solutions and processes, prepare documentation, monitor inventory, and support workflow and process management for clients as well as colleagues across the Machinify Platforms.

What you’ll do

  • Monitor client inventory in Machinfy and client systems.
  • Perform requirements gathering to problem solve for client issues arising in Operations’ day-to-day activities and implement appropriate processes to monitor resolution by utilizing the Client Action Log and Jira ticketing system.
  • Enter, track, and follow up on tickets to ensure timely resolution for client production issues.
  • Support internal Operations teams through regularly scheduled team meetings to determine appropriate process is handling changing needs including rule changes, process flow modifications, escalations.
  • Support the client invoicing and/or reconciliation processes.
  • Generate and transmit client reporting as required.
  • Communicate and discuss larger issues with IT and Operations teams, continuing to act as liaison between teams until issues fully resolved.
  • Attend external working client meetings with leadership teams and communicate pertinent information to appropriate internal teams, acting as a support system to client teams.
  • Set up new users for clients in Machinify’s systems.
  • Maintain system access requirements for client systems to perform inventory management work as necessary.
  • Perform QA and UAT efforts as necessary.
  • Other duties as assigned.

What experience you bring (Role Requirements)

  • 2+ years’ experience in data production preferred; and health industry knowledge and experience a strong plus.
  • Proven experience with business and technical requirements analysis, elicitation, modeling, verification, and methodology development
  • Experience managing multiple clients/projects in a team environment
  • Experience independently structuring and executing complex analyses
